gpt4 book ai didi

java - 如何将 SharedPreferences 存储到文件中?

转载 作者:行者123 更新时间:2023-11-30 11:48:21 26 4
gpt4 key购买 nike

我一直在开发 Android 应用程序,它应该具有以下功能:它应该在应用程序执行之间存储一些数据;另外,如果我删除应用程序并重新安装它,应用程序应该恢复数据值。我知道我可以将数据存储到 SharedPreferences(用于在我的程序中处理数据)并在 onDestroy() 事件中序列化到文件中。但是 SharedPreferences 是不可序列化的类,我不能使用它。请为我的任务建议另一种方法,或者告诉我如何序列化 SharedPreferences。我知道我可以将重要数据写入简单文件,但可能有另一种方法可以解决我的问题?谢谢

最佳答案

删除应用程序后,您将无法在本地存储数据,除非您将数据放在 SD 卡上,但那时每个人都可以读/写/删除它。

查看此以获取有关数据存储的更多信息:

http://developer.android.com/guide/topics/data/data-storage.html#filesExternal

关于java - 如何将 SharedPreferences 存储到文件中?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8856589/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com